LVMH Key Account Coordinator
LVMH Fragrance Brands, a prestigious division of the LVMH Group, is renowned for its exquisite portfolio of luxury perfumes and cosmetics. As a leader in the industry, LVMH Fragrance Brands offers a dynamic and innovative work environment, fostering creativity and excellence. Employees are part of a global network that values diversity, collaboration, and professional growth.
- Update and maintain the Sell-Out tracker for each retailer weekly.
- Request and analyze trade reports to identify performance trends and issues.
- Provide monthly corporate report analysis, including retailer rankings and trade marketing activities.
- Track and analyze sell-through, stock holding, and launch performance, offering business-driving suggestions.
- Distribute Daily Gross Sales reports and provide weekly best-seller and stock level reports to retailers.
- Validate incoming orders, ensuring alignment with launch allocations and stock availability.
- Monitor logistics calendar and manage supply-chain processes.
- Assist in organizing promotional activities and maintaining P&L through internal trackers.
- Complete New Line Forms and administer retailer information exchanges.
- Set up Purchase Orders, ensure budget compliance, and manage invoice coding.
- Conduct competitor analysis and maintain records of promotional activities.
